关于电脑语言的分类和定义,综合权威资料整理如下:
一、主要分类
机器语言 由0和1组成的二进制代码,是计算机能直接执行的指令集,具有执行速度快但难以记忆的特点。
汇编语言
以助记符替代机器语言指令,与机器语言一一对应,便于人类阅读和编写,但灵活性较低。
高级语言
接近人类自然语言,如C、Java、Python等,易学易用,适合复杂算法和系统开发。
二、其他分类方式
按执行方式: 解释型语言
按应用领域:
包括系统开发、数据库管理(如SQL)、游戏开发、数据分析等专用语言。
三、常见编程语言示例
| 类型 | 代表语言 | 特点及应用领域 |
|------------|----------------|-------------------------------------------|
| 低级语言 | 汇编语言 | 与机器指令对应,效率最高|
| 高级语言 | C/C++ | 系统/游戏开发,性能优异|
| 解释型语言 | Python | 数据科学、自动化脚本|
| 脚本语言 | JavaScript | Web交互、服务器端开发 |
四、语言级别特点
| 级别 | 与人类语言接近度 | 灵活性 | 效率 |
|------------|----------------|--------|--------|
| 机器语言 | 最低 | 最高 | 最高 |
| 汇编语言 | 中等 | 中等 | 高 |
| 高级语言 | 最高 | 低 | 中等 |
总结:电脑语言是人与计算机沟通的桥梁,根据执行方式和复杂度可分为机器语言、汇编语言和高级语言三大类。不同语言在效率、易用性和适用场景上各有侧重,开发者需根据需求选择合适的语言。